/** Sets the vertical scroll position so 'row' is at the top,
and causes the screen to redraw.
*/
void Fl_Table::row_position(int row) {
if ( _row_position == row ) return; // OPTIMIZATION: no change? avoid redraw
if ( row < 0 ) row = 0;
else if ( row >= rows() ) row = rows() - 1;
if ( table_h <= tih ) return; // don't scroll if table smaller than window
double newtop = row_scroll_position(row);
if ( newtop > vscrollbar->maximum() ) {
newtop = vscrollbar->maximum();
}
vscrollbar->Fl_Slider::value(newtop);
table_scrolled();
redraw();
_row_position = row; // HACK: override what table_scrolled() came up with
}
/**
Sets the horizontal scroll position so 'col' is at the left,
and causes the screen to redraw.
*/
void Fl_Table::col_position(int col) {
if ( _col_position == col ) return; // OPTIMIZATION: no change? avoid redraw
if ( col < 0 ) col = 0;
else if ( col >= cols() ) col = cols() - 1;
if ( table_w <= tiw ) return; // don't scroll if table smaller than window
double newleft = col_scroll_position(col);
if ( newleft > hscrollbar->maximum() ) {
newleft = hscrollbar->maximum();
}
hscrollbar->Fl_Slider::value(newleft);
table_scrolled();
redraw();
_col_position = col; // HACK: override what table_scrolled() came up with
}
/**
Returns the scroll position (in pixels) of the specified 'row'.
*/
long Fl_Table::row_scroll_position(int row) {
int startrow = 0;
long scroll = 0;
// OPTIMIZATION:
// Attempt to use precomputed row scroll position
//
if ( toprow_scrollpos != -1 && row >= toprow ) {
scroll = toprow_scrollpos;
startrow = toprow;
}
for ( int t=startrow; t<row; t++ ) {
scroll += row_height(t);
}
return(scroll);
}
/**
Returns the scroll position (in pixels) of the specified column 'col'.
*/
long Fl_Table::col_scroll_position(int col) {
int startcol = 0;
long scroll = 0;
// OPTIMIZATION:
// Attempt to use precomputed row scroll position
//
if ( leftcol_scrollpos != -1 && col >= leftcol ) {
scroll = leftcol_scrollpos;
startcol = leftcol;
}
for ( int t=startcol; t<col; t++ ) {
scroll += col_width(t);
}
return(scroll);
}
/**
The constructor for Fl_Table.
This creates an empty table with no rows or columns,
with headers and row/column resize behavior disabled.
*/
Fl_Table::Fl_Table(int X, int Y, int W, int H, const char *l) : Fl_Group(X,Y,W,H,l) {
_rows = 0;
_cols = 0;
_row_header_w = 40;
_col_header_h = 18;
_row_header = 0;
_col_header = 0;
_row_header_color = color();
_col_header_color = color();
_row_resize = 0;
_col_resize = 0;
_row_resize_min = 1;
_col_resize_min = 1;
_redraw_toprow = -1;
_redraw_botrow = -1;
_redraw_leftcol = -1;
_redraw_rightcol = -1;
table_w = 0;
table_h = 0;
toprow = 0;
botrow = 0;
leftcol = 0;
rightcol = 0;
toprow_scrollpos = -1;
leftcol_scrollpos = -1;
_last_cursor = FL_CURSOR_DEFAULT;
_resizing_col = -1;
_resizing_row = -1;
_dragging_x = -1;
_dragging_y = -1;
_last_row = -1;
_auto_drag = 0;
current_col = -1;
current_row = -1;
select_row = -1;
select_col = -1;
_scrollbar_size = 0;
flags_ = 0; // TABCELLNAV off
_colwidths = 0;
_colwidths_size = 0;
_colwidths_alloc = 0;
_rowheights = 0;
_rowheights_size = 0;
_rowheights_alloc = 0;
box(FL_THIN_DOWN_FRAME);
vscrollbar = new Fl_Scrollbar(x()+w()-Fl::scrollbar_size(), y(),
Fl::scrollbar_size(), h()-Fl::scrollbar_size());
vscrollbar->type(FL_VERTICAL);
vscrollbar->callback(scroll_cb, (void*)this);
hscrollbar = new Fl_Scrollbar(x(), y()+h()-Fl::scrollbar_size(),
w(), Fl::scrollbar_size());
hscrollbar->type(FL_HORIZONTAL);
hscrollbar->callback(scroll_cb, (void*)this);
table = new Fl_Scroll(x(), y(), w(), h());
table->box(FL_NO_BOX);
table->type(0); // don't show Fl_Scroll's scrollbars -- use our own
table->hide(); // hide unless children are present
table->end();
table_resized();
redraw();
Fl_Group::end(); // end the group's begin()
table->begin(); // leave with fltk children getting added to the scroll
}
/**
The destructor for Fl_Table.
Destroys the table and its associated widgets.
*/
Fl_Table::~Fl_Table() {
// The parent Fl_Group takes care of destroying scrollbars
if (_colwidths) free(_colwidths);
if (_rowheights) free(_rowheights);
}
/**
Returns the current number of columns.
This is equivalent to the size of the column widths vector.
\returns Number of columns.
*/
int Fl_Table::col_size() {
return _colwidths_size;
}
/**
Returns the current number of rows.
This is equivalent to the size of the row heights vector.
\returns Number of rows.
*/
int Fl_Table::row_size() {
return _rowheights_size;
}
/**
Sets the height of the specified row in pixels,
and the table is redrawn.
callback() will be invoked with CONTEXT_RC_RESIZE
if the row's height was actually changed, and when() is FL_WHEN_CHANGED.
*/
void Fl_Table::row_height(int row, int height) {
if ( row < 0 ) return;
if ( row < row_size() && _rowheights[row] == height ) {
return; // OPTIMIZATION: no change? avoid redraw
}
// Add row heights, even if none yet
if (row >= _rowheights_size) {
// Need to grow array
int newsize = row + 1;
if (newsize > _rowheights_alloc) {
int newalloc = _rowheights_alloc ? _rowheights_alloc * 2 : 8;
if (newalloc < newsize) newalloc = newsize;
_rowheights = (int*)realloc(_rowheights, newalloc * sizeof(int));
_rowheights_alloc = newalloc;
}
// Fill new entries with height
int i;
for (i = _rowheights_size; i < newsize; i++)
_rowheights[i] = height;
_rowheights_size = newsize;
}
_rowheights[row] = height;
table_resized();
if ( row <= botrow ) { // OPTIMIZATION: only redraw if onscreen or above screen
redraw();
}
// ROW RESIZE CALLBACK
if ( Fl_Widget::callback() && when() & FL_WHEN_CHANGED ) {
do_callback(CONTEXT_RC_RESIZE, row, 0);
}
}
/**
Sets the width of the specified column in pixels, and the table is redrawn.
callback() will be invoked with CONTEXT_RC_RESIZE
if the column's width was actually changed, and when() is FL_WHEN_CHANGED.
*/
void Fl_Table::col_width(int col, int width)
{
if ( col < 0 ) return;
if ( col < col_size() && _colwidths[col] == width ) {
return; // OPTIMIZATION: no change? avoid redraw
}
// Add column widths, even if none yet
if ( col >= _colwidths_size ) {
// Need to grow array
int newsize = col + 1;
if (newsize > _colwidths_alloc) {
int newalloc = _colwidths_alloc ? _colwidths_alloc * 2 : 8;
if (newalloc < newsize) newalloc = newsize;
_colwidths = (int*)realloc(_colwidths, newalloc * sizeof(int));
_colwidths_alloc = newalloc;
}
// Fill new entries with width
int i;
for (i = _colwidths_size; i < newsize; i++)
_colwidths[i] = width;
_colwidths_size = newsize;
}
_colwidths[col] = width;
table_resized();
if ( col <= rightcol ) { // OPTIMIZATION: only redraw if onscreen or to the left
redraw();
}
// COLUMN RESIZE CALLBACK
if ( Fl_Widget::callback() && when() & FL_WHEN_CHANGED ) {
do_callback(CONTEXT_RC_RESIZE, 0, col);
}
}
/**
Return specified row/col values R and C to within the table's
current row/col limits.
\returns 0 if no changes were made, or 1 if they were.
*/
int Fl_Table::row_col_clamp(TableContext context, int &R, int &C) {
int clamped = 0;
if ( R < 0 ) { R = 0; clamped = 1; }
if ( C < 0 ) { C = 0; clamped = 1; }
switch ( context ) {
case CONTEXT_COL_HEADER:
// Allow col headers to draw even if no rows
if ( R >= _rows && R != 0 ) { R = _rows - 1; clamped = 1; }
break;
case CONTEXT_ROW_HEADER:
// Allow row headers to draw even if no columns
if ( C >= _cols && C != 0 ) { C = _cols - 1; clamped = 1; }
break;
case CONTEXT_CELL:
default:
// CLAMP R/C TO _rows/_cols
if ( R >= _rows ) { R = _rows - 1; clamped = 1; }
if ( C >= _cols ) { C = _cols - 1; clamped = 1; }
break;
}
return(clamped);
}
/**
Returns the (X,Y,W,H) bounding region for the specified 'context'.
*/
void Fl_Table::get_bounds(TableContext context, int &X, int &Y, int &W, int &H) {
switch ( context ) {
case CONTEXT_COL_HEADER:
// Column header clipping.
X = tox;
Y = wiy;
W = tow;
H = col_header_height();
return;
case CONTEXT_ROW_HEADER:
// Row header clipping.
X = wix;
Y = toy;
W = row_header_width();
H = toh;
return;
case CONTEXT_TABLE:
// Table inner dimensions
X = tix; Y = tiy; W = tiw; H = tih;
return;
// TODO: Add other contexts..
default:
fprintf(stderr, "Fl_Table::get_bounds(): context %d unimplemented\n", (int)context);
return;
}
//NOTREACHED
}

/**
Recalculate the dimensions of the table, and affect any children.
Internally, Fl_Group::resize() and init_sizes() are called.
*/
void Fl_Table::recalc_dimensions() {
// Recalc to* (Table Outer), ti* (Table Inner), wi* ( Widget Inner)
wix = ( x() + Fl::box_dx(box())); tox = wix; tix = tox + Fl::box_dx(table->box());
wiy = ( y() + Fl::box_dy(box())); toy = wiy; tiy = toy + Fl::box_dy(table->box());
wiw = ( w() - Fl::box_dw(box())); tow = wiw; tiw = tow - Fl::box_dw(table->box());
wih = ( h() - Fl::box_dh(box())); toh = wih; tih = toh - Fl::box_dh(table->box());
// Trim window if headers enabled
if ( col_header() ) {
tiy += col_header_height(); toy += col_header_height();
tih -= col_header_height(); toh -= col_header_height();
}
if ( row_header() ) {
tix += row_header_width(); tox += row_header_width();
tiw -= row_header_width(); tow -= row_header_width();
}
// Make scroll bars disappear if window large enough
{
// First pass: can hide via window size?
int hidev = (table_h <= tih);
int hideh = (table_w <= tiw);
int scrollsize = _scrollbar_size ? _scrollbar_size : Fl::scrollbar_size();
// Second pass: Check for interference
if ( !hideh && hidev ) { hidev = (( table_h - tih + scrollsize ) <= 0 ); }
if ( !hidev && hideh ) { hideh = (( table_w - tiw + scrollsize ) <= 0 ); }
// Determine scrollbar visibility, trim ti[xywh]/to[xywh]
if ( hidev ) { vscrollbar->hide(); }
else { vscrollbar->show(); tiw -= scrollsize; tow -= scrollsize; }
if ( hideh ) { hscrollbar->hide(); }
else { hscrollbar->show(); tih -= scrollsize; toh -= scrollsize; }
}
// Resize the child table
table->resize(tox, toy, tow, toh);
table->init_sizes();
}
/**
Recalculate internals after a scroll.
Call this if table has been scrolled or resized.
Does not handle redraw().
TODO: Assumes ti[xywh] has already been recalculated.
*/
void Fl_Table::table_scrolled() {
// Find top row
int y, row, voff = vscrollbar->value();
for ( row=y=0; row < _rows; row++ ) {
y += row_height(row);
if ( y > voff ) { y -= row_height(row); break; }
}
_row_position = toprow = ( row >= _rows ) ? (row - 1) : row;
toprow_scrollpos = y; // OPTIMIZATION: save for later use
// Find bottom row
voff = vscrollbar->value() + tih;
for ( ; row < _rows; row++ ) {
y += row_height(row);
if ( y >= voff ) { break; }
}
botrow = ( row >= _rows ) ? (row - 1) : row;
// Left column
int x, col, hoff = hscrollbar->value();
for ( col=x=0; col < _cols; col++ ) {
x += col_width(col);
if ( x > hoff ) { x -= col_width(col); break; }
}
_col_position = leftcol = ( col >= _cols ) ? (col - 1) : col;
leftcol_scrollpos = x; // OPTIMIZATION: save for later use
// Right column
// Work with data left over from leftcol calculation
//
hoff = hscrollbar->value() + tiw;
for ( ; col < _cols; col++ ) {
x += col_width(col);
if ( x >= hoff ) { break; }
}
rightcol = ( col >= _cols ) ? (col - 1) : col;
// First tell children to scroll
draw_cell(CONTEXT_RC_RESIZE, 0,0,0,0,0,0);
}
/**
Call this if table was resized, to recalculate internal data.
Calls recall_dimensions(), and recalculates scrollbar sizes.
*/
void Fl_Table::table_resized() {
table_h = (int)row_scroll_position(rows());
table_w = (int)col_scroll_position(cols());
recalc_dimensions();
// Recalc scrollbar sizes
// Clamp scrollbar value() after a resize.
// Resize scrollbars to enforce a constant trough width after a window resize.
//
{
// Vertical scrollbar
float vscrolltab = ( table_h == 0 || tih > table_h ) ? 1 : (float)tih / table_h;
float hscrolltab = ( table_w == 0 || tiw > table_w ) ? 1 : (float)tiw / table_w;
int scrollsize = _scrollbar_size ? _scrollbar_size : Fl::scrollbar_size();
vscrollbar->bounds(0, table_h-tih);
vscrollbar->precision(10);
vscrollbar->slider_size(vscrolltab);
vscrollbar->resize(wix+wiw-scrollsize, wiy,
scrollsize,
wih - ((hscrollbar->visible())?scrollsize:0));
vscrollbar->Fl_Valuator::value(vscrollbar->clamp(vscrollbar->value()));
// Horizontal scrollbar
hscrollbar->bounds(0, table_w-tiw);
hscrollbar->precision(10);
hscrollbar->slider_size(hscrolltab);
hscrollbar->resize(wix, wiy+wih-scrollsize,
wiw - ((vscrollbar->visible())?scrollsize:0),
scrollsize);
hscrollbar->Fl_Valuator::value(hscrollbar->clamp(hscrollbar->value()));
}
// Tell FLTK child widgets were resized
Fl_Group::init_sizes();
// Recalc top/bot/left/right
table_scrolled();
// DO *NOT* REDRAW -- LEAVE THIS UP TO THE CALLER
// redraw();
}

/**
Moves the selection cursor a relative number of rows/columns specifed by R/C.
R/C can be positive or negative, depending on the direction to move.
A value of 0 for R or C prevents cursor movement on that axis.
If shiftselect is set, the selection range is extended to the new
cursor position. If clear, the cursor is simply moved, and any previous
selection is cancelled.
Used mainly by keyboard events (e.g. Fl_Right, FL_Home, FL_End..)
to let the user keyboard navigate the selection cursor around.
The scroll positions may be modified if the selection cursor traverses
into cells off the screen's edge.
Internal variables select_row/select_col and current_row/current_col
are modified, among others.
\code
Examples:
R=1, C=0 -- moves the selection cursor one row downward.
R=5, C=0 -- moves the selection cursor 5 rows downward.
R=-5, C=0 -- moves the cursor 5 rows upward.
R=2, C=2 -- moves the cursor 2 rows down and 2 columns to the right.
\endcode
*/
int Fl_Table::move_cursor(int R, int C, int shiftselect) {
if (select_row == -1) R++;
if (select_col == -1) C++;
R += select_row;
C += select_col;
if (R < 0) R = 0;
if (R >= rows()) R = rows() - 1;
if (C < 0) C = 0;
if (C >= cols()) C = cols() - 1;
if (R == select_row && C == select_col) return 0;
damage_zone(current_row, current_col, select_row, select_col, R, C);
select_row = R;
select_col = C;
if (!shiftselect || !Fl::event_state(FL_SHIFT)) {
current_row = R;
current_col = C;
}
if (R < toprow + 1 || R > botrow - 1) row_position(R);
if (C < leftcol + 1 || C > rightcol - 1) col_position(C);
return 1;
}
/**
Same as move_cursor(R,C,1);
*/
int Fl_Table::move_cursor(int R, int C) {
return move_cursor(R,C,1);
}

/**
See if the cell at row \p r and column \p c is selected.
\returns 1 if the cell is selected, 0 if not.
*/
int Fl_Table::is_selected(int r, int c) {
int s_left, s_right, s_top, s_bottom;
if (select_col > current_col) {
s_left = current_col;
s_right = select_col;
} else {
s_right = current_col;
s_left = select_col;
}
if (select_row > current_row) {
s_top = current_row;
s_bottom = select_row;
} else {
s_bottom = current_row;
s_top = select_row;
}
if (r >= s_top && r <= s_bottom && c >= s_left && c <= s_right) {
return 1;
}
return 0;
}
/**
Gets the region of cells selected (highlighted).
\param[in] row_top Returns the top row of selection area
\param[in] col_left Returns the left column of selection area
\param[in] row_bot Returns the bottom row of selection area
\param[in] col_right Returns the right column of selection area
\internal
This method is 'const' since FLTK 1.5 (and 1.4.5 ABI), see issue #1305
*/
void Fl_Table::get_selection(int& row_top, int& col_left, int& row_bot, int& col_right) const {
if (select_col > current_col) {
col_left = current_col;
col_right = select_col;
} else {
col_right = current_col;
col_left = select_col;
}
if (select_row > current_row) {
row_top = current_row;
row_bot = select_row;
} else {
row_bot = current_row;
row_top = select_row;
}
}
/**
Sets the region of cells to be selected (highlighted).
So for instance, set_selection(0,0,0,0) selects the top/left cell in the table.
And set_selection(0,0,1,1) selects the four cells in rows 0 and 1, column 0 and 1.
To deselect all cells, use set_selection(-1,-1,-1,-1);
\param[in] row_top Top row of selection area
\param[in] col_left Left column of selection area
\param[in] row_bot Bottom row of selection area
\param[in] col_right Right column of selection area
*/
void Fl_Table::set_selection(int row_top, int col_left, int row_bot, int col_right) {
damage_zone(current_row, current_col, select_row, select_col);
current_col = col_left;
current_row = row_top;
select_col = col_right;
select_row = row_bot;
damage_zone(current_row, current_col, select_row, select_col);
}
